Sign Up A new app has been created to help reduce drug-related harm and deaths across the north of Scotland. The Highland Overdose Prevention and Engagement (Hope) app has been developed by Highland Alcohol and Drugs Partnership (HADP), with input from people with lived experience and a range of experts from NHS Highland and beyond.

Shang-Chi s Simu Liu defends deleting Mark Wahlberg tweet

At the age of 16, Wahlberg was convicted of assault against two Vietnamese men, with police reports stating that at the time of his arrest he had used racial slurs against the victims. After pleading guilty, Wahlberg was sentenced to two years in prison but served only 45 days of his term. In 2014, Wahlberg requested to be pardoned for the crime and issued an apology, with Liu expressing his feelings about the matter four years later as he tweeted: Let me get this straight, Mark Wahlberg beat a helpless Vietnamese man with a stick until he passed out when he was 16, and is attempting to get the courts to grant him an official pardon on the basis that he s turned his life around ?
